Arm swing

Having come fresh from the Coaching in Running Fitness course at the weekend, I thought I would give a little lesson on one of the things I learned, and that was ARM SWING! It's something probably none of us really think about but actually it can make you a much more efficient runner. Here is a great video from one of my favourite runners that explains it in a bit more detail.

So we focussed on 3 things: Making sure the arms did not cross the mid line, driving the elbows backwards, and trying to maintain a 90 degree angle in the elbow the whole time and not extending the arm back when you swing back.

Hopefully this will give you something to think about and work on during your next few runs. It will feel weird and unnatural to begin with but stick with it. The main one is the rotation through the midline. That one creates a lot of wasted energy so if you're going to focus on ONE thing, let it be that and just try and drive the arms forward and backwards rather than across the body.

We did a few laps trying it out and then got into pairs to observe each other because it's so hard to tell if you're doing it correctly yourself! After a few attempts we called it a night and finished with a stretch.

We did some hills with a twist... usually in hill repeats you would run at a decent pace up the hill and then recover on the way down, but downhill running is just as important and a skill in itself so we practiced running fast on both with a flat section in between each one to recover. Some great efforts by everyone! Nice to see people FLY down (and up) those hills!

After 5 minutes we trotted back to the uni for part 2! A little core tabata featuring plank jacks and bicycle crunches. Having a strong core is super important for running as it keeps you holding good running form and posture for longer so you are able to run faster and further! And who wouldn't want that!?
